Huntsville restaurant closes last location: ‘My heart is so heavy’

Before becoming a restauranteur, Tom Brown had already lived a few other lives.

As he put it in our 2020 interview, “A lot of everything. I had an air ambulance charter business back in California. Did real estate for over 20 years.” As a teenager, Brown worked in restaurants in Texas and later as an adult did so in Mississippi.

Now, after closing the second and final location of his self-titled Alabama restaurants — Tom Brown’s Restaurant in south Huntsville, following a 2024 closure of the original, Madison location – Brown is returning full-time to a past occupation…
